Birth Partner Volunteer Coordinator
Are you passionate about birth rights and positive birth experiences?
At The Birth Partner Project, our vision is that no woman or birthing person should face birth alone. We provide volunteer birthing partners to people seeking sanctuary, across Cardiff.

Summary of the Role
The successful candidate will:
- Work hand-in-hand with our existing Birth Partner Volunteer Coordinator, to recruit and train a pipeline of well trained, active volunteers
- Actively participate as a Birth Partner alongside our volunteers, leading and supporting teams as necessary to bolster our volunteering capacity
- Link directly with our referral partners at Cardiff and Vale University Health Board, to ensure referrals are managed effectively
- Collaborate among the team and volunteers, to drive developments and improvements inthe service, and support the sustainability and growth of the charity
